Hot Chip have unveiled their new single and announced their new album, as well as three UK headline shows for May.
The band recently teased new material with a short clip on Domino Records' website - confirming their new album Why Make Sense? Their fifth album, In Our Heads, was released in 2012.
Now, it has been revealed that sixth LP Why Make Sense? will be released on 18 May, 2015. The band have also unveiled glorious new single 'Huarahce Lights' - a blissed-out odysssey of sweet disco and electro that latter-day LCD Soundsystem would have been proud of.
Since it was announced that they'll play at the BBC 6 Music Festival on 20 February, as well as Green Man in August, the band have now announced a trio of UK shows sandwiched inbetween.
They'll play at Glasgow Art School on 12 May, before heading to Manchester's Gorilla, finishing up at London's Oval Space on 14 May.
